A quick definition of à rendre:

Term: À RENDRE

Definition: À rendre means to give back or return something that belongs to someone else. It is a legal term that comes from the French language. When you borrow something, you have to rendre it to the owner when you are done using it. It is important to rendre things on time and in good condition.

A more thorough explanation:

À RENDRE

À rendre is a term from Law French that means to render or yield.

  • He owed the money, and it was à rendre to the creditor.
  • The defendant was ordered to pay damages à rendre to the plaintiff.

These examples illustrate how à rendre is used in legal contexts to refer to the obligation to pay or yield something to another party. In both cases, there is a debt or obligation that must be fulfilled, and à rendre indicates that the debtor must render or yield the required payment or compensation.
